| +// The pairing authenticator builds on top of V2Authenticator to add
|
| +// support for PIN-less authentication via device pairing:
|
| +//
|
| +// * If a client device is already paired, it includes in the initial
|
| +// authentication message a Client Id and the first SPAKE message
|
| +// using the Paired Secret and HMAC_SHA256.
|
| +// * If the host recognizes the Client Id, it looks up the corresponding
|
| +// Paired Secret and continue the SPAKE exchange.
|
| +// * If it does not recognize the Client Id, it initiates a SPAKE exchange
|
| +// with HMAC_SHA256 using the PIN as the shared secret. The initial
|
| +// message of this exchange includes an an error message, which
|
| +// informs the client that the PIN-less connection failed and causes
|
| +// it to prompt the user for a PIN to use for authentication
|
| +// instead.
|
| +// * If, at any point, the SPAKE exchange fails with the Paired Secret,
|
| +// the endpoint that detects the failure initiates a new SPAKE exchange
|
| +// using the PIN, and includes an error message to instruct the peer
|
| +// to do likewise.
|
| +//
|
| +// If a client device is not already paired, but supports pairing, then
|
| +// the V2Authenticator is used instead of this class. Only the method name
|
| +// differs, which the client uses to determine that pairing should be offered
|
| +// to the user (see NegotiatingHostAuthenticator::CreateAuthenticator and
|
| +// NegotiatingClientAuthenticator::CreateAuthenticatorForCurrentMethod).
